R406 is a potent Syk inhibitor with IC50 of 41 nM, strongly inhibits Syk but not Lyn, 5-fold less potent to Flt3. Phase 1.
An IgE and IgG- mediated Fc signaling activation inhibitor.

| Solubility | DMSO 126 mg/mL; Water <1 mg/mL; Ethanol 8 mg/mL |
